Residential tile repair services involve fixing and restoring damaged or deteriorated tiles within a home’s interior or exterior spaces. This work typically includes replacing broken or cracked tiles, re-grouting areas where the grout has become stained or loose, and addressing underlying issues that may cause tiles to loosen or crack over time. Skilled service providers can also handle surface leveling and sealing to ensure that the repaired areas blend seamlessly with the surrounding tilework, restoring both appearance and functionality.
Tile problems in homes often result from everyday wear and tear, moisture exposure, or accidental impacts. Common issues include cracked tiles in kitchens and bathrooms, loose tiles in entryways or hallways, and grout lines that have become discolored or crumbly. These issues can lead to safety hazards, such as tripping, as well as aesthetic concerns that diminish the overall look of a space. Residential tile repair services help homeowners resolve these problems efficiently, preventing further damage and extending the life of their tile surfaces.
Properties that frequently utilize tile repair services include single-family homes, townhouses, and condominiums. Kitchens and bathrooms are the most common areas where tile damage occurs, given the moisture and frequent use these spaces experience. Additionally, entryways, laundry rooms, and outdoor patios with tile surfaces may require repairs due to weather exposure or heavy foot traffic. The overview below groups typical Residential Tile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Meridian, ID.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or tile repairs, such as replacing a few cracked or damaged tiles,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on tile size and accessibility.
Moderate Restoration - For more extensive repairs like re-grouting or replacing multiple tiles, local contractors often charge between $600-$1,500. Projects in this range are common for mid-sized areas needing attention.
Full Tile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a tiled area, such as a bathroom or kitchen, can cost from $1,500-$5,000+, with larger or more complex projects reaching higher totals.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, especially if custom work is involved.
Full Floor Overhaul - Larger, more comprehensive tile renovations or installations typically range from $5,000 and up, depending on the size and complexity of the space. Many service providers handle projects in this range, though costs can vary based on materials and sc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of tile surfaces can residential repair services handle? Local contractors are experienced in repairing various tile surfaces, including ceramic, porcelain, stone, and glass tiles found in kitchens, bathrooms, and entryways.
How do repair services address cracked or chipped tiles? Service providers can assess the damage and perform repairs such as filling cracks, replacing broken tiles, or regrouting to restore the appearance and functionality.
Can tile repair services help with loose or uneven tiles? Yes, local contractors can re-adhere loose tiles, level uneven surfaces, and ensure tiles are securely installed for a smooth, even finish.
What solutions are available for grout deterioration or discoloration? Repair professionals can clean, replace, or re-grout tiles to improve appearance and prevent further damage caused by grout issues.
Are tile repairs suitable for both indoor and outdoor residential spaces? Many local service providers can handle repairs in both indoor areas like kitchens and bathrooms, as well as outdoor patios and walkways.
